Description
FEATURES
- Exact OEM replacement bearing and seal kits bring back the steering and braking control lost due to worn or rusted wheel bearings.
- Each kit includes necessary bearings and seals to completely rebuild each hub.
- Double-sealed ball bearings keep moisture and contamination from entering bearing.
- Seals ensure proper fitment.

Vehicle Information
Yamaha TY350 Dirt Bike (1985-1986)
The Yamaha TY350, a trials motorcycle, was produced from 1985 to 1986. This model was known for its single-cylinder, two-stroke engine, delivering consistent performance for trials riding. Although engine displacement varied slightly, from 341cc in 1985 to 346cc in 1986, horsepower remained consistent at 25 hp. This minor revision did not constitute a significant generational break or a major change in performance characteristics. The model was primarily offered as a single "Trials" version for both years.
